Title
Calculation of field enhancement factor and screening effects in carbon nanotube arrays

Abstract
Computational 3D simulations of individual carbon nanotubes (CNTs) and vertically aligned arrays of CNTs were conducted in order to gain insight into their field emission characteristics. We find that the widely used approximation that the enhancement factor is equal to the aspect ratio of the emitter to be an over-estimation, and that the enhancement factor is only loosely related to the aspect ratio, among other parameters.
